TLDR: I visited Mel's on Madison and was impressed by their great customer service and delicious food made in-house. The prices are a bit high, but it's worth it for the tasty meal and unique cheesecake flavors made by the owner's daughter. Highly recommend a visit for a fantastic dining experience. FULL: Mel's on Madison has been on my radar since its opening, and I finally had the opportunity to dine there recently. Upon arrival, we were warmly welcomed by the entire staff, and even the owner took the time to personally introduce himself and share information about his restaurant, including the fact that all dishes are made in-house with the exception of the toasted raviolis, which are sourced pre-made. We started with the toasted raviolis, which were not only delicious, but also served piping hot. For the main course, I opted for a medium rare 8oz tenderloin steak, accompanied by garlic mashed potatoes, coleslaw, and a house salad(not pictured). The food arrived promptly, within 15 minutes, and did not disappoint. The steak was succulent and full of flavor, the garlic mashed potatoes were exceptional, the coleslaw was satisfactory, and the house salad, though small, was appropriately sized for a single serving. For dessert, the owner informed us that his daughter made a variety of cheesecakes, including blueberry and espresso. I chose the espresso cheesecake and was thoroughly impressed by its richness, creaminess, and sweetness. Although the prices at Mel's on Madison are on the higher side, the exceptional customer service and delicious food make it a worthwhile dining experience. I would highly recommend a visit to anyone seeking a delightful culinary experience.

We stopped in after the restaurant we had planned on going to was unexpectedly closed, just a few doors down. The building itself is intriguing so we stopped into Mel’s for a bite. The servers were so friendly, and although they were short staffed on a busy Saturday lunch, they greeted us and we had our drinks in no time. (And if you don’t have patience and understanding of what it’s like to be short staffed and busy at a restaurant, I suggest you put yourself in the workers positions before you even mutter a negative thought or review.) It took us a while to decide what to order because it all sounded good. We ordered Mel’s Mac appetizer with pulled pork, a cheddar bacon burger, and the Caesar salad wrap—we saw someone with it while walking in, and it looked very appetizing. None of the food was a disappointment! I wish I had thought to take photos before we ate several bites. The servers were very accommodating and provided me with extra pickles. That in itself merits automatic five stars. We live over an hour away, but we will return!

Had a nice lunch this afternoon at Mel's on Madison. Our server Ashley was exceptional. She was very personable and knowledgeable and answered our questions about the various sauces we might like to try. If you like horseradish, the homemade horseradish aioli was excellent and we will try the Tri Tip sandwich the next time we visit. Be sure to eat a slice of homemade cheesecake. The Butterfinger option was so delicious, we took Cookies and Cream and Strawberry Lemonade home with us. The cheesecakes change weekly so we must try them all!
